Output ec6c39124cb869283f7de9f70b18fa12d0ea6b2082fba8df2618aff14c5b83f8:1

value
93228630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e42ebc74e5a8db1152f69ffde6eb25b02b77f1 OP_EQUAL
address
39cTPSgXhHqcAx4SasKmBDRoot39LQ1bid
transaction
ec6c39124cb869283f7de9f70b18fa12d0ea6b2082fba8df2618aff14c5b83f8
spent
true